暗号資産(仮想通貨)の高速取引を可能にする最新ツール紹介
暗号資産(仮想通貨)市場は、その変動性と成長の可能性から、世界中の投資家やトレーダーの関心を集めています。しかし、取引速度は、特に高頻度取引やアービトラージ戦略において、重要な要素です。取引速度が遅いと、機会損失や予期せぬ損失につながる可能性があります。本稿では、暗号資産取引を高速化するための最新ツールについて、その機能、利点、および考慮事項を詳細に解説します。
1. 高速取引の重要性
暗号資産市場は、従来の金融市場と比較して、ボラティリティが高い傾向にあります。価格は短時間で大きく変動することがあり、わずかな遅延が大きな損失につながる可能性があります。高速取引は、以下の点で重要です。
- 機会の最大化: 価格変動のわずかな差を利用して利益を得る高頻度取引やアービトラージ戦略において、高速取引は不可欠です。
- スリッページの軽減: スリッページとは、注文価格と実際に約定した価格との差のことです。高速取引は、スリッページを最小限に抑えるのに役立ちます。
- 流動性の高い市場へのアクセス: 高速取引ツールは、複数の取引所に接続し、流動性の高い市場にアクセスするのに役立ちます。
- リスク管理の向上: 高速取引は、迅速なポジション調整を可能にし、リスク管理を向上させます。
2. 主要な高速取引ツール
暗号資産取引を高速化するためのツールは、大きく分けて以下の3つのカテゴリに分類できます。
2.1 取引所API
ほとんどの暗号資産取引所は、API(Application Programming Interface)を提供しています。APIを使用することで、プログラムを通じて取引所の機能にアクセスし、自動的に注文を発注したり、市場データを取得したりすることができます。APIは、高速取引の基礎となる技術であり、多くの高度なツールで使用されています。
APIを使用する際の考慮事項:
- APIレート制限: 取引所は、APIの使用頻度を制限することがあります。レート制限を超えると、APIへのアクセスが一時的に停止される可能性があります。
- APIの信頼性: 取引所のAPIは、常に安定して動作するとは限りません。APIのダウンタイムが発生すると、取引が中断される可能性があります。
- セキュリティ: APIキーは、厳重に管理する必要があります。APIキーが漏洩すると、不正アクセスや資金の盗難につながる可能性があります。
2.2 取引ボット
取引ボットは、事前に定義されたルールに基づいて自動的に取引を行うプログラムです。取引ボットは、APIを使用して取引所に接続し、市場データを分析して、最適なタイミングで注文を発注します。取引ボットは、高頻度取引やアービトラージ戦略に特に有効です。
代表的な取引ボット:
- Zenbot: オープンソースの取引ボットであり、Node.jsで記述されています。
- Gekko: オープンソースの取引ボットであり、JavaScriptで記述されています。
- Haasbot: 商用取引ボットであり、高度な機能とカスタマイズオプションを提供しています。
取引ボットを使用する際の考慮事項:
- バックテスト: 取引ボットを実際に使用する前に、過去のデータを使用してバックテストを行い、そのパフォーマンスを評価する必要があります。
- リスク管理: 取引ボットは、自動的に取引を行うため、リスク管理が重要です。損失を限定するためのストップロス注文を設定するなど、適切なリスク管理対策を講じる必要があります。
- 監視: 取引ボットは、常に監視する必要があります。予期せぬ事態が発生した場合に、迅速に対応できるようにする必要があります。
2.3 コロケーションサービス
コロケーションサービスは、取引所のサーバーと同じデータセンターにサーバーを設置することで、ネットワーク遅延を最小限に抑えるサービスです。コロケーションサービスは、特に高頻度取引を行うトレーダーにとって有効です。ネットワーク遅延がわずかに減少するだけで、取引の成功率が大きく向上する可能性があります。
コロケーションサービスを使用する際の考慮事項:
- コスト: コロケーションサービスは、高価なサービスです。
- 技術的な専門知識: コロケーションサービスを利用するには、サーバーの設置や管理に関する技術的な専門知識が必要です。
- 取引所との連携: コロケーションサービスを利用するには、取引所との連携が必要です。
3. 高速取引ツールの比較
以下の表は、主要な高速取引ツールの比較を示しています。
| ツール | 機能 | 利点 | 欠点 | コスト |
|---|---|---|---|---|
| 取引所API | 自動取引、市場データ取得 | 柔軟性、カスタマイズ性 | 技術的な専門知識が必要、APIレート制限 | 無料 |
| Zenbot | 自動取引、バックテスト | オープンソース、無料 | 技術的な専門知識が必要、カスタマイズが難しい | 無料 |
| Gekko | 自動取引、バックテスト | オープンソース、使いやすい | カスタマイズが難しい | 無料 |
| Haasbot | 自動取引、バックテスト、高度な機能 | 高度な機能、カスタマイズオプション | 高価 | 有料 |
| コロケーションサービス | ネットワーク遅延の最小化 | 取引速度の向上 | 高価、技術的な専門知識が必要 | 有料 |
4. 高速取引におけるセキュリティ対策
高速取引ツールを使用する際には、セキュリティ対策が非常に重要です。以下に、いくつかのセキュリティ対策を示します。
- APIキーの保護: APIキーは、厳重に管理し、漏洩しないように注意する必要があります。
- 二段階認証: 取引所の口座には、二段階認証を設定する必要があります。
- VPNの使用: VPNを使用して、インターネット接続を暗号化する必要があります。
- ソフトウェアのアップデート: 使用しているソフトウェアは、常に最新の状態にアップデートする必要があります。
- 定期的な監査: システムのセキュリティを定期的に監査する必要があります。
5. まとめ
暗号資産市場における高速取引は、競争力を維持し、利益を最大化するために不可欠です。本稿では、高速取引を可能にする最新ツールについて、その機能、利点、および考慮事項を詳細に解説しました。取引所API、取引ボット、コロケーションサービスは、それぞれ異なる特徴を持っており、トレーダーのニーズやスキルに応じて最適なツールを選択する必要があります。また、高速取引ツールを使用する際には、セキュリティ対策を徹底し、リスク管理を適切に行うことが重要です。暗号資産市場は常に進化しており、新しいツールや技術が登場しています。常に最新の情報を収集し、最適な取引戦略を構築することが、成功への鍵となります。